Oil-Dri Corporation of America is a leading manufacturer and supplier of specialty sorbent products for consumer and business-to-business markets that has been voted as a Top 100 workplaces in the Chicago Tribune. Oil-Dri's products are sold in the pet care, animal health, fluids purification, agricultural, sports field, industrial and automotive markets. Oil-Dri controls millions of tons of specialty mineral reserves, including calcium bentonite, attapulgite, and diatomaceous shale. The company's mines and manufacturing facilities are located in Georgia, Mississippi, Illinois, and California. Oil-Dri is a family-controlled and operated organization that emphasizes honesty, integrity, and accountability. The company is dedicated to fulfilling its mission to Create Value From Sorbent Minerals. Role Overview The Packaging Front Line Supervisor provides leadership and direction to teammates to attain short- and long-term goals, optimize team effectiveness, and meet daily work schedules in the Packaging/Warehouse Department. Drive improvements in safety, morale, and cost control.

Responsibilities

  • Achieve departmental goals and metrics by supervising packaging teammates, achieving safety goals, productivity goals, material usage targets, inventory targets, product quality requirements and equipment yield.
  • Ensure teammates perform work according to established safety rules and practices, environmental and housekeeping standards while striving for ZERO Accidents.
  • Understands customer quality requirements, assures teammates understand and follow these requirements.
  • Implements and assures procedures are followed to detect and eliminate nonconforming incoming supplies.
  • Implements and assures procedures are followed for the packaging department.
  • Partner with Human Resources in staffing and retention of packaging and warehouse teammates.
  • Coordinate purchase of supplies necessary to ensure functioning of packaging department.
  • Coordinate with Processing Supervisor to ensure clay supply for packaging operations is satisfactory.
  • Supervise, train and develop, and review packaging staff.
  • Plans packaging and loading operations, establishing priorities and sequences for packaging products.
  • Communicate key metrics to Plant leadership and production teams to stimulate process improvement and cost reduction.
  • Partner with Maintenance and Process Improvement to coordinate maintenance activities to meet established preventative maintenance goals.
  • Maintain procedure manuals and training aids.
  • Establish and ensure effectiveness of packaging teammates training.
  • Gather and analyze data; make recommendations for process improvements and cost reductions.
  • Meet line efficiency goals along with crew efficiencies and maximize daily packaging production.
  • Complete required reporting and documentation.
